Stone backsplash installation services involve the process of selecting and professionally installing natural or manufactured stone materials onto kitchen or bathroom walls. This service typically includes preparing the wall surface, measuring and cutting the stone to fit specific spaces, and securely affixing the material to ensure a durable and visually appealing finish. Skilled installers can work with a variety of stone types, such as granite, marble, slate, or quartzite, to achieve the desired aesthetic and functional outcome. Proper installation is essential to prevent issues like cracking, moisture penetration, or uneven surfaces that can compromise both the appearance and longevity of the backsplash.

One of the primary benefits of stone backsplash installation is addressing common problems associated with traditional tile or paint finishes. Stone surfaces are highly resistant to heat, moisture, and staining, making them an ideal choice for kitchens and bathrooms. This service hel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and staining that can occur with less durable wall coverings. Additionally, stone backsplashes are easier to clean and maintain, re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ements. Properly installed stone backsplashes also elevate the overall aesthetic of a space, adding a touch of natural elegance and sophistication.

Properties that typically feature stone backsplash installation include residential kitchens and bathrooms, especially those with a focus on upscale or modern design. In homes, stone backsplashes are often used to create a striking focal point behind cooking areas or sinks, complementing countertops and cabinetry. Commercial properties, such as restaurants, boutique hotels, or retail spaces, may also utilize stone backsplashes to enhance interior aesthetics and create a durable, easy-to-clean surface in high-traffic areas. The versatility of stone allows it to suit various interior styles, from rustic to contemporary, making it a popular choice across different property types.

Material Costs - Stone backsplash installation costs typically include the price of materials, which can range from $20 to $70 per square foot depending on the type of stone, such as granite, marble, or quartz. The total expense depends on the size of the area being covered and the quality of the stone selected.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a stone backsplash generally fall between $45 and $85 per hour. For an average kitchen, labor might total $300 to $1,200, depending on the complexity of the design and the local market rates.

Project Size Impact - Larger backsplash areas tend to increase overall costs, with projects of 30 square feet typically ranging from $600 to $2,100 for materials and installation combined. Smaller projects may cost less, while intricate designs can add to expenses.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for surface preparation, cutting, or custom fabrication, which can add $100 to $500 to the total cost. These fees depend on the existing condition of the walls and the specific requirements of the installation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one are commonly used for backsplashes? Popular options include granite, marble, quartz, and slate,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.

How long does stone backsplash installation typically take? Installation times vary based on project size and complexity, but generally, it can be completed within a few days.

Can stone backsplashes be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, in many cases, stone can be installed over existing backsplashes or surfaces, depending on their condition and compatibility.

What maintenance is required for a stone backsplash? Regular cleaning with mild, non-abrasive cleaners and sealing as recommended by the manufacturer helps maintain the appearance and longevity of the stone.
